GOAL: Preserve privacy screening provided by foliage while protecting tree limbs and wires from mutual harm caused by long term abrasive contact.

            Limbs pressing & rubbing on telecom

                           Wires shown above

 

SOLUTION: Limbs pulled away from wires with galvanized steel cable. Rubber tubing used to protect tree bark   ---->
